
Photo taken on Feb. 2, 2018 shows a piece of compressed wood (Top, C) and its original form (Bottom, C) at the University of Maryland, Maryland, the United States. U.S. researchers said Wednesday that they have developed a simple way to make wood as strong as steel or even titanium alloys, opening up possible applications in areas such as buildings, cars and airplanes.
